Fabric Singeing: Where Fire Meets Precision
Walk into any textile mill and you’ll spot something counterintuitive—workers guiding fabrics over open flames. This isn’t a relic of the past but a calculated step called singeing, a process that transforms raw textiles into smooth, pill-resistant materials. Let’s break down why this fiery technique remains irreplaceable.
The Nuts and Bolts
Every time yarns rub against machinery during spinning or weaving, they shed tiny fibers. These loose threads clump into a fuzzy layer that makes fabrics look unkempt and prone to pilling. Singeing fixes this by running cloth at high speed over flames (think less than two seconds of exposure) or red-hot metal plates. The trick lies in burning off just the fluff without cooking the fabric itself.
Why Factories Bother
That quick dance with fire does more than tidy up appearances. By zapping 0.5-3mm surface fibers, singeing cuts future pilling incidents by half. It’s also water-smart—compared to older scouring methods, it saves enough H₂O to fill three bathtubs per ton of fabric. Plus, the smoother surface lets dyes grip evenly, meaning fewer uneven patches in your favorite shirt.
The Art of Not Burning Down the Mill
Veteran operators liken singeing to cooking steak—timing and temperature make or break the result. Too cool, and fluff remains; too hot, and fibers crisp like overcooked noodles. They tweak three dials:
- Flame height (thumb-width gaps between burners)
- Heat levels (650-850°C, roughly a volcano’s breath)
- Fabric speed (18-35 meters/minute, faster than a sprinting mouse)
Modern sensors help, but seasoned workers still adjust flames by eye. One factory manager told me, “The machine reads numbers—we read the fabric’s whispers.”
Not All Heat Treatments Are Equal
Newcomers often mix up singeing with carbonizing. Here’s the cheat sheet:
- Singeing skims the surface (like toasting bread’s crust)
- Carbonizing bakes deeper (think croutons)
- Mess up carbonizing? Your fabric loses 15% strength—bad news for suit jackets.
- Wool usually gets carbonized; everyday cottons and polyesters go through singeing.
Lasers Enter the Chat
Some tech-forward mills now swap flames for lasers. These pinpoint beams selectively burn fluff off intricate patterns without singeing edges—a game-changer for jacquard curtains or brocade upholstery. Early adopters report fabrics gaining a subtle sheen, almost like they’ve been lightly ironed.

Singeing and Bio-Polishing Buyer Guide
Fabric singeing removes loose surface fibers with controlled flame, while bio-polishing uses enzymes to create a cleaner, smoother handfeel. These processes do not create burnout transparency, but they help prepare a cleaner surface for premium denim, washing, printing, coating or other decorative finishing.
For buyers comparing finishing options, singeing and bio-polishing should be reviewed together with pilling risk, surface cleanliness, color depth and final garment handfeel. Over-processing can weaken the surface or change the look of indigo denim, so sample approval is still necessary.


Surface Finishing Checklist
| Finish | Main effect | Buyer should confirm |
|---|---|---|
| Singeing | Burns off protruding surface fibers. | Surface cleanliness, shade change and fabric safety. |
| Bio-polishing | Uses enzymes to reduce fuzz and improve smoothness. | Handfeel, pilling, strength and wash result. |
| Singeing before print/coating | Creates a cleaner surface for decoration. | Compatibility with flocking, coating, print or burnout effects. |
